Contraction within the mammalian heart is controlled from the intracellular Ca2+ focus as it is in all striated muscle mass, but the guts has a further signaling method that comes into Perform to boost coronary heart amount and cardiac output all through exercise or strain. β-adrenergic stimulation of coronary heart muscle mass cells causes launch of cyclic-AMP along with the activation of protein kinase A which phosphorylates critical proteins during the sarcolemma, sarcoplasmic reticulum and contractile equipment. Troponin I (TnI) and Myosin Binding Protein C (MyBP-C) tend to be the primary targets inside the myofilaments. TnI phosphorylation lowers myofibrillar Ca2+-sensitivity and raises the velocity of Ca2+-dissociation and leisure (lusitropic result). Latest research have shown that this romantic relationship amongst Ca2+-sensitivity and TnI phosphorylation could possibly be unstable.
